How much do computer vision eng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 5, 2026, the average yearly pay for computer vision engineer in Blacksburg, VA is $106,595.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$97,800.00 and $115,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a computer vision engineer?

Computer Vision Engineers are professionals who develop algorithms and systems that enable computers to interpret and process visual information from the world, such as images and videos. They work on tasks like object detection, facial recognition, image segmentation, and more, often using machine learning and deep learning techniques. These engineers apply their expertise in fields like robotics, autonomous vehicles, healthcare, and augmented reality, turning raw visual data into actionable insights.

What is the difference between Computer Vision Engineer vs Machine Learning Engineer?

AspectComputer Vision EngineerMachine Learning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's or Master's in CS, Electrical Engineering, or related; knowledge of image processing and computer vision librariesBachelor's or Master's in CS, Data Science, or related; strong programming and statistical skills
Work EnvironmentDevelops algorithms for image/video analysis, object detection, and recognition in tech, automotive, or healthcare industriesBuilds models for various data types, including text, images, and structured data across multiple sectors
Employer & Industry UsageTech companies, autonomous vehicles, robotics, healthcareTech firms, finance, e-commerce, healthcare, and research institutions

While both roles involve machine learning techniques, Computer Vision Engineers specialize in developing algorithms for visual data, whereas Machine Learning Engineers work on broader data modeling across various data types. The roles often overlap but differ mainly in focus and application areas.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a computer vision eng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Computer Vision Engineer, you need a strong background in computer science, mathematics, and machine learning, often supported by a relevant degree and experience with image processing algorithms. Familiarity with tools and frameworks such as OpenCV, TensorFlow, PyTorch, and proficiency in programming languages like Python or C++ is essential, along with knowledge of deep learning techniques. Analytical thinking, creativity, and effective communication are standout soft skills for this role. These skills and qualities are crucial for developing innovative vision solutions, interpreting complex data, and collaborating efficiently within interdisciplinary teams.

What does a computer vision engineer do?

Computer vision is a branch of artificial intelligence that attempts to replicate human analytical processes by using algorithms and computer models to understand and identify patterns in images. As a computer vision engineer, you use software to handle the processing and analysis of large data populations, and your efforts support the automation of predictive decision-making efforts. Your responsibilities involve research, programming, data analysis, and user interface design. You may work on a variety of exciting development projects like self-driving cars, mobile devices, innovative features and capabilities in sports and entertainment, and the next generation of social media enhancements.

What are some common challenges faced by computer vision engineers when deploying models to production environments?

Computer Vision Engineers often encounter challenges such as ensuring model accuracy in diverse real-world conditions, optimizing models for efficiency on edge devices, and handling large-scale data processing. Deploying models to production requires balancing performance with resource constraints and addressing issues like latency, scalability, and data privacy. Collaborating closely with software engineers and data scientists is crucial to integrate solutions effectively and continuously monitor and improve model performance in live applications.

Job Summary:
We are seeking an accomplished Embedded Software SME with expertise in Extended Reality (XR) and advanced visual systems to join our innovative Research & Development organization, developing the next generation of Warfighter-borne visual systems. In this role, you will drive the architecture, development, and integration of next-generation embedded software solutions supporting immersive visual technologies for mission-focused applications.
You will work at the intersection of real-time embedded systems, computer vision, sensor fusion, and XR display technologies. This role is ideal for someone who likes hands-on work, excels in complex system environments, and is passionate about pushing the boundaries of human-machine interaction.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Lead design and development of embedded software for XR and visual system platforms, including AR/VR/MR display systems, sensor pipelines, and real-time rendering components.
  • Serve as the technical authority for embedded architecture, device-level software, and low-level system integration across hardware, firmware, and application layers.
  • Develop system requirements, interface definitions, and design documentation that ensure scalability, performance, and reliability in mission-critical environments.
  • Integrate embedded XR software with optical systems, imaging sensors, inertial measurement units, tracking systems, and display hardware.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including electrical, mechanical, optical, and systems engineering, to deliver cohesive and high-performance visual solutions.
  • Drive technology maturation efforts, evaluate emerging technologies, and guide R&D investments in XR and advanced visual systems.
  • Mentor engineering teams and contribute to best practices, development standards, and technical reviews.
  • Support prototype buildouts, system demos, and field evaluations.

Education, Experience/Knowledge & License/Certification:
Required Qualifications:
  • A bachelor's or master's degree in computer engineering, electrical engineering, computer science, or a related field.
  • 10+ years of experience in embedded software development for high-performance or real-time systems.
  • Expertise with C/C++, embedded Linux/RTOS, and hardware-centric development workflows.
  • Proven experience with XR technologies, including AR/VR/MR headsets, optical systems, camera pipelines, or visual-inertial tracking.
  • Deep understanding of graphics pipelines, GPU/accelerator programming, or real-time rendering concepts.
  • Strong systems-level thinking and ability to lead designs across multiple engineering disciplines.

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Experience with Unity, Unreal Engine, OpenXR, Vulkan, or similar XR/graphics frameworks.
  • Knowledge of computer vision, sensor fusion, or real-time signal processing.
  • Experience with aerospace, defense, or safety-critical system development.
  • Familiarity with model-based design tools, simulation environments, or digital twin ecosystems.
  • Background in leading multidisciplinary teams or serving in technical leadership roles.
  • Experience with three and six-degree-of-freedom extended reality systems.
